Ali Kişmir’s Trial Adjourned to October 30

The trial of journalist and Press Workers’ Union (Basın-Sen) President Ali Kişmir, who faces up to 10 years in prison over a social media post, has been adjourned to October 30.

The case, which is being heard at the Constitutional Court, concerns an article Kişmir shared online.
Kişmir is being represented by Turkish Cypriot Bar Association President Hasan Esendağlı. The next hearing is scheduled for Thursday, October 30.
